Minister Rebrands MOHR As Kesuma

The Ministry of Human Resources has rebranded itself with the abbreviation of KESUMA which are the first to letters of each word of the ministry in its Bahasa Melayu name.

The full name of the ministry in Bahasa Melayu is Kementerian Sumber Manusia and incidentally the word Kesuma also means flower in the language. The ministry helmed by the new Minister Steven Sim Chee Keong has decided to change the name as he felt the mission of the ministry corresponded with the strategic 3K initiative namely empowering Welfare, Skills, and Employee success.

Since taking over, the ministry said the Minister has strengthen cooperation with trade unions, implement reforms on the institution of the Malaysian Industrial Court, emphasised workers’ wage rights, expand the coverage of social security schemes, improve quality of training skills, and implemented several steps to improve governance in all departments and agencies of the ministry.

Accordingly, from March 4, 2024, the name of the Ministry of Human Resources with the abbreviation (KESUMA) will be used officially on all related matters within the Ministry.
